Just a Little Mouse
This little mouse is full of curry. Even healthier than normal vegetarian Japanese curry to be precise. I'm very proud of this particular curry because I managed to sneak baby spinach into it by cutting the spinach into fine strips. I don't think A-chan noticed. She certainly ate every bite last night so I'm considering this another triumph for nutritious eating! So far I've managed to sneak kabocha, cauliflower, zucchini and spinach into our curry. Only one at a time, though. The next challenge is to add two or more and see if she balks, hehe. I have been enjoying these small changes to our regular recipes. Even though they are not large portions of extra vegetables, my philosophy is better some than none. We are eating a little healthier every day!
In the bento: Bread and curry rolls, carrot flowers, black olives, corn on the cob, a huge strawberry and steamed broccoli.
My favorite parts of the mouse are the corn kernel earrings. Her face was made with provolone cheese, nori, ketchup cheeks and a pick for the nose. The large carrot flowers were decorated with black sesame seeds, the small flowers have either a sugar dot or a tiny provolone cheese circle.

Hot dog mouse
The cute little mouse hiding in this bento was inspired by Maki Ogawa at Cute Obento. Her amazingly cute hot dog and sausage characters have been making me oooh and aaah for years! I haven't been able to come close to creating the cuteness that she does, but her tutorials and creative ideas keep me trying.
In the bento: Vegetarian hot dog mouse, cherry tomato halves, grapes on heart picks, steamed broccoli, vegetable fried rice with baby corn, green peas, carrots, onion, scrambled tofu and shitake mushrooms.
Half of a hot dog makes the mouse. There is a wedge cut out to allow room for his ears which are just hot dog slices with provolone cheese centers. His mouth is a provolone cheese heart with a tiny pink sugar dot for a nose. He has a little tail but I don't know if it's really visible against the tomato.
